  • Publication number: 20110299446
    Abstract: A method of performing a handover in a wireless communication system employing a macro base station and a femto base station is provided. The method comprising: monitoring an uplink signal transmitted from a user equipment to the macro base station; transmitting a handover initiation message to the macro base station on the basis of a result of comparing the uplink signal's strength obtained by the monitoring with a reference value; and performing a handover of the user equipment from the macro base station to the femto base station. According to the present invention, there is provided a method of initiating a handover by a femto base station by fining user equipments located in a cell coverage of the femto base station. In addition, a signaling overhead is reduced by utilizing previously existing information such as uplink transmit power.
